    Mine:

    Floyd Mayweather Jr: Manny Pacquiao
    will be the obvious one due to the insane amount of money it would generate.

    Andre Ward: Move up to 175 and fight Adonis Stevenson. I think that Stevenson at 175 is an easy nights work for Ward, even in Canada. (Obviously if you're Ward's promoter, it's probably hard to convince him to do anything).

    Manny Pacquiao: See Floyd Mayweather Jr

    Roman Gonzalez:
    The best fight in boxing that could and should be made Juan Francisco Estrada rematch.

    Timothy Bradley: Pretty confident that Bradley could expose Keith Thurman, capture an interim title, in a fight that would obviously be picked up by HBO or Showtime and do well.

    Juan Manuel Marquez: A fight with Marcos Rene Maidana would be an entertaining war. Maidana has a lot of exposure in big fights (Mayweather x2, Broner, Ortiz, Khan) and I think Marquez has a counter punchers field day.

    Carl Froch: A big Vegas PPV fight with Julio Cesar Chavez Jr.

    Wladimir Klitschko: Provided he gets by Pulev, Tyson Fury has the kind of personality to sell fights and is fairly ****.

    Guillermo Rigondeaux: Leo Santa Cruz is developing a following and would be an entertaining fight by Rigondeaux standards

    Juan Francisco Estrada: See Roman Gonzalez

    I would love to see Bradley-Thurman. Its one of those fights that probably cant be made, unfortunately. Not unless Thurman can somehow dump Haymon, and deal exclusively with Oscar. In which case, it probably would happen because both guys are badly in need of each other really.

    Thurman needs a bigger name, Bradley needs a fresh face that has some value.
